The number "1300" in your query often refers to a specific Support Code. According to the Canon Knowledge Base, Support Code 1300 typically indicates a paper jam in the paper output slot or the rear tray.

Clearing the Error: Turn off the machine, slowly pull the jammed paper out with both hands to avoid tearing, and then restart the printer.

Preventing Future Jams: Ensure the paper is not curled and that the paper guides are snug against the stack.

The Canon F15 1300 is the regulatory model number for the Canon Laser Shot LBP3000 (also known as the i-SENSYS LBP3000

). To find and download the correct drivers, you should search for the model name on official Canon support sites rather than the regulatory code. Where to Download Drivers

You should always download drivers from official Canon regional websites to ensure compatibility and security: Canon Asia Support: Drivers for the LASER SHOT LBP3000 Canon Europe Support: Drivers for the i-SENSYS LBP3000 Canon New Zealand: Offers the CAPT Printer Driver for various Windows and macOS versions. How to Install the Driver

According to Canon Asia and Microsoft Support, follow these steps:

Disconnect the USB Cable: Ensure the printer is not connected to your computer before you start the installation.

Download the File: Select the driver compatible with your operating system (e.g., Windows 10 x64) and save the .exe file.

Decompress the File: Double-click the downloaded file to extract it; a new folder with the same name will be created.

Run Setup: Open the new folder and double-click Setup.exe to begin the installation wizard.

Connect the Printer: Plug in the USB cable only when prompted by the installer.
